Germany: Saar, Wonderful, Nearly Complete Parallel Mint and Used Collection, 1920-59. A one-of-a-kind collection presented in a Lindner hingeless album at its capacity limit; missing just a few items (mostly used!) for total completion; mint includes Germania overprints complete with #17 signed, Ludwig overprints complete with #20, 38 and 39 signed; multiples and varieties on "Saargebiet" overprints, a tête-bêche #68a and 85a, a beautiful #116 Proof, Semi-Postals including #B9-B15, B64a (never hinged), CB1a (never hinged); Airs with #C1-C4, C5-C8 (C7 never hinged); 1947 regular and surcharged sets complete, plus Saarland and Officials; used includes Germanias and Ludwigs complete (#35-38 signed), Saargebiet, Mark and Franken sets, Airs complete less #C7, 1947 sets complete, CB1a (signed), even an amazing #B64a tied on cover (!); clean and bright throughout, with even the used exceptionally well-centered, Very Fine, an amazing accomplishment; even if this isn't your area, you have to see it to believe it. Germany: Saar, Complete Mint Collection, 1920-59. In a Lindner hingeless album with slipcase; complete less a handful of items, with all but the 5pf 1920 issue never hinged; German and French currency issues are all here, with crisp and bright Germanias, a wealth of overprinted issues, Semi-Postals complete (less #B9-B15), including both Flood Relief souvenir sheets, Europas, Airs, Officials, etc.; an exceptionally pretty collection, Very Fine, well worth viewing, various 1920 issues signed, with 2013 A.P.S. certificate for #37. Germany: Saar, The Freikorps Specialized Collection, 1920-21. Unique specialized collection of the Saarland's first issues, in mint/used singles and multiples (and on pieces) extensively organized with the different overprints, plate types/faults, shades and other varieties, in two albums with hand-written descriptions. Germany: Saar, Collection, 1920-1958. In Lindner hingeless album, of both mint and used issues, with 1-17 on piece, 99-116, 120-35 mint and used, 139-54 (2 mint sets), B1-4 used, B5-8 mint and used, B9-15 mint set and B9-14 used, B16-22 mint and used, B23-29 used (mostly used on small piece), B30-36 mint and used, B37-43 mint and used, B44-46 mint and used, B47-53 used, B54-60 mint and used, B64a used, C12 mint and used, CB1a, generally Fine to Very Fine.
